In the framework of the low emittance high brilliance Elettra 2.0 project four 130 kW continuous way 500 MHz Solid State Amplifiers (SSA) have been installed and commissioned. These SSAs are already used for the RF plants in operation at Elettra having replaced the aged klystron and IOT based amplifiers. This paper discusses the current progress of the 400 kW Solid-State Power Amplifier operating at 352 MHz for the European Spallation Source (ESS), developed by ESS in collaboration with Uppsala University. It details the initial measurements of critical components, including the Solid-State Power Amplifier (SSPA) module, which has a nominal output power of 1.6 kW.
